Bae Doo-na to join Wachowskis’ ’Cloud Atlas’
Actress Bae Doo-na will star in the Wachowski Brothers’ next project based on a 2004 novel by award-winning writer David Mitchell. Bae has joined the screen adaptation of centuries-spanning novel ``Cloud Atlas,'' which starts filming this week The book consists of six interlinking stories of six individuals at different points in time that span from 19th century to a post-apocalyptic period. Bae is expected to play a futurist character from the year 2144. According to reports, the film directors were impressed with Bae’s performance in “Air Doll” and asked to have a meeting with her. Her co-stars will include Tom Hanks, Halle Berry, Susan Sarandon, Hugo Weaving, Jim Broadbent, Ben Wishaw, and China's Zhou Xun, among others. The film is currently in pre-production with a planned October 2012 release. The movie has three directors ― ``Matrix'' trilogy creators the Wachowski Brothers and ``Run Lola Run'' director Tom Tykwer. Filming will take place in Scotland, Spain and Germany. |
